“Great Hotel”

Hilton Virginia Beach Oceanfront

5 of 5 stars
chicago, illinois
Jul 18, 2008

I stayed in this hotel for a three night reward stay. Great experience. I was given a corner room with two windows, one facing the city, and one facing the beach line. Amazing. My brother and I were put on the 17th floor, an HHonors floor, and given access to the lounge on the 20th floor for breakfast / snacks.

The room was really nice, especially the bathroom. The shower had glass doors and a dual-shower head. The room was quite large. I think being a corner room helped out with the size. The only bad thing about the room was that the Widescreen HDTV did not have any HD channels, but this was no big deal since I only watched 15 minutes of TV the entire weekend.

The hotel staff was great. Everybody we ran into in either an elevator or front desk was really nice. The pool on the rooftop was amazing. A great place to catch some sun when you get sick of laying on the beach. There were quite a few kids up there though, but they mainly stayed in the indoor pool.

We only ate at the catch 31 restaurant for lunch. Server was great, and food was reasonable for lunch prices. Good food.

I found myself wondering why people would bother to complain about some of the things in the other reviews:
1. The elevators were quick, I never waited more than 30 seconds for an elevator. They also move up and down quickly. Even when we had to make 5-6 stops our total elevator time was never over one minute.
2. Parking garage. We chose to self park. Half the garage spaces are marked as Hotel Guest / Permit parking only. There are public spaces in this garage, but you must have a hotel tag to park in the hotel spots. There were always plenty of hotel spots available, although we did see some public spots filling up quickly.

By far the nicest hotel on Virginia Beach. Had several friends staying at other various hotels along the beach that same weekend. We were glad to be staying at the Hilton after seeing their rooms, they were totally blown away by our room.

“If you enjoy good service, don't come here.”

Hilton Virginia Beach Oceanfront

2 of 5 stars
woodbridge, va
Jul 7, 2008
1/1 found this review helpful

Booked 2 nights, July 5-7, as a romantic getaway using my Hilton Honors points. I requested a room with a fridge and a balcony. Didn't get the balcony and the fridge cost $10 a day. Oh and so does internet if you want access. It's even more expensive if you use the business center since they charge for that too. Rooms were okay, nothing great. You have the option to self park your car -- that is if the lot's not full since that lot is shared with public parking, hotel guests are not guaranteed a space. Valet was rude and they wouldn't let us use the hotel cart without a bellman accompanying us. So we made sure not to use their valet services. Elevators are extremely slow.

Catch 31, one of their hotel restaurants, hostess staff was slow and unattentative. It took them 10 minutes to recognize that we were standing in front of them before acknowledging us. They quoted us an hour long wait but it only took 25 minutes. Rob, our server, was great and one of our better highlights of our stay. The food was good. We also had dinner at Salacia and the food was excellent, so was Patrick , our server.

As a Hilton Honors Silver member, I was not treated any differently than the guy next to me who isn't a member. Hilton normally allows later check-outs beyond an hour and the front desk got rude with me when I asked for 1.5 hour late checkout. He said he would charge me. Most of their staff is in dire need of taking Hospitality 101. Poor service comes from the top and obviously GoldKey management and reality doesn't invest in making sure their employess offer superior services. The lack of good, friendly and warm service doesn't match the nice look of the hotel.

“Nice Hotel Overall, Mixed Bag”

Hilton Virginia Beach Oceanfront

Jun 9, 2008

One of the better hotels on the beach - has a Hilton quality but does not go the extra mile to exceed it. I would definitely stay here again and again though! This is a great hotel overall.

Good stuff - clean rooms, comfy, excellent location, great rooftop bar, nice rooftop pool (although slightly small in relative terms), awesome lobby (especially at night), Catch 31 the seafood restaurant is excellent but definitely pricey (the bar is very hip and also the #1 place to be at night), parking is good to have right across the street, friendly maid staff

Other things to consider - got here on a "sand soccer weekend" and the place was swamped with kids (including the rooftop pool), they need more elevators - the ones they have are quick but they are not enough to accommodate large crowds, kind of weird walking through the lobby in my bathing suit past folks in suits for a wedding reception

I would recommend this hotel for almost the whole spectrum of potential visitors. It also would be an excellent place to host a team meeting or conference. This will be a hotel to return to at least once a year.

“Hilton Virginia Beach - Average to Good”

Hilton Virginia Beach Oceanfront

3 of 5 stars
Atlanta, Georgia
May 25, 2008

I stayed here in May 2008. Overall I thought the hotel was fairly good, except there were some inconveniences that made me not give it 4 stars. This included the fact that the room I was given even though it was a corner ocean view room I was not impressed. One of the walls needed a paint job. The room seemed fairly small from what I am used of.

I was surprised that at a beach location their was no safe deposit box, refrigerator, or microwave in the hotel room. I requested the refrigerator, got one for a fee. Did not like the fact that to use the business center computers was a fee. If I had know, I would have bought my laptop with me because they charge by the minute very expensive. As a Diamond member I was expecting better, and a good upgraded room. What's the use of a membership, if you don't see the differentiating benefits.

In addition, the complimentary guest services that's available in the hotel to help you plan and find activities to do, where using half the time to make a sells pitch for new time shares that really put me off.

The lobby, restaurants, and pool though I thought was overall good. In addition, to the easy access to the beach, also complimentary beach towels are available for hotel guest (towel a bit small though). If not for these elements they would have gotten a 1 or 2 stars from me. Cheers!
